Are the national museums in Sri Lanka undergoing a reorganization?

The Department of Archaeology is currently working on concept papers for a total reorganization of several state museums. This is a long term project to modernize the display of our artifacts. Currently, all major museums like the Colombo National Museum and the Anuradhapura Museum remain open to the public. The reorganization is focusing on better documentation and digital integration for future visitors.
